Isaiah 25:7

WEB

7He will destroy in this mountain the surface of the covering that covers all peoples, and the veil that is spread over all nations.

KJV

7And he will destroy in this mountain the face of the covering cast over all people, and the vail that is spread over all nations.

BSB

7On this mountain He will swallow up the shroud that enfolds all peoples, the sheet that covers all nations;

FBV

7On this mountain he will destroy the veil that covers all the nations, the sheet that is over everyone.
